What companies run services between Stockton-on-Tees, England and Skegness, England?

You can take a train from Thornaby to Skegness via Darlington and Grantham in around 4h 52m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Yarm Lane temporary coach stop adj Yarm St to Dorothy Avenue via Doncaster Frenchgate Interchange/C7, Doncaster Frenchgate Interchange/B3, Retford Bus Station, Rail Station Car Park, Central Bus Station, and Mill Inn in around 9h 37m.
